| Could you live on just over $18,000 a year for retirement? It's one reason why you shouldn't just lean on Social Security to finance your post-employment years. |
| Add one more business to the list of those hampered by the COVID-19 pandemic. Ruby Tuesday's announced it's filing for Chapter 11 bankruptcy protection. As part of the process, it will close 185 restaurants. |
| Finally, some good news on the restaurant front: McDonald's is adding three new sweet treats to its menu. |
